The Correct Pronunciation of Fila
The name "Fila" is often mispronounced, especially by those unfamiliar with its Italian roots. The correct pronunciation is Fee-lah, with a soft "ee" sound followed by a short "lah." It’s important to note that the emphasis is on the first syllable, giving it a light and crisp feel.
Originating from Biella, Italy, Fila was founded in 1911 by Filippo Fila, who began as a small manufacturer of woolen fabrics. Over time, the company evolved into one of the world’s leading sportswear brands, known for its distinctive logo and classic designs. The correct pronunciation reflects the brand’s Italian heritage and adds an authentic touch when discussing the brand with others.
The History and Impact of Fila
Understanding the history of Fila can help deepen your appreciation for the brand. Founded over a century ago, Fila has grown from a local textile business to a global powerhouse in sportswear. The brand’s journey is marked by innovation and a commitment to quality, which has earned it a loyal following worldwide.
In the 1970s, Fila made significant strides in the tennis world, partnering with legends like Björn Borg. This association catapulted the brand into the spotlight and cemented its reputation for high-performance apparel. Today, Fila continues to innovate, blending its classic designs with modern technology to cater to a diverse range of athletes and fashion enthusiasts.
Fila’s Place in Modern Culture
While Fila is celebrated for its athletic wear, it has also become a staple in streetwear and fashion. The brand’s versatile designs, such as the iconic "Disruptor" sneaker and the "Polartec" jacket, have been embraced by celebrities and fashion icons alike. This crossover into mainstream culture has further solidified Fila’s status as a timeless and relevant brand.
From the tennis court to the fashion runway, Fila has managed to stay relevant through strategic collaborations and a focus on quality. The brand’s ability to blend functionality with style has made it a favorite among both athletes and fashion-forward individuals.
